Output e0fbe1afec95c854c0659d5a6878deea27be2b39156dbe30a16085e25c8073e5:0

value
10650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3767dad8f997dd1b036c9c1097215f10b1b0d OP_EQUAL
address
3BMEXnHqwQ4j8Sq5nPaCdLnMEEejzugv19
transaction
e0fbe1afec95c854c0659d5a6878deea27be2b39156dbe30a16085e25c8073e5
confirmations
309221
spent
true